Born in Oakland from Purple City Genetics, Grape Tarts pairs a candy-forward cut of Y So Grapey with the producer-friendly Street Tarts ( Guava Tart x Street Guru ), yielding a modern dessert-gas hybrid that leans as luscious as it looks. The nose pops first with jammy concord grape and red-berry candy, then widens into tropical pastry and light fuel; on the palate, sweet grape leads while tropical and confection tones linger. In the room, plants stack dense, resin-sheathed calyxes that readily blush dark violet, especially under cooler nights. Expect vigorous lateral branching and an easy to train structure that rewards canopy work with heavy yields. Indoors, most phenotypes finish in roughly 56-63 days, with production-oriented cuts pushing toward the later side. Effects arrive in a balanced arc: a cheerful lift and gentle euphoria settle into a relaxed, content body feel without flattening focus. The terpene profile typically puts myrcene and caryophyllene up front with lilting linalool, mirroring the strain's fruit-plus-gas personality. While exact potency depends on selection, the line reliably shows low CBD and THC levels squarely in the contemporary, high-powered range.
